+/* ============================================================================
+ * =                                wifi                                      =
+ * ============================================================================
+ */
+static bool check_wlan0(struct socket *sock)
+{
+       /* FIXME: hardcode interface */
+       const char *name_intrf = "wlan0";
+
+       if (sock->sk->sk_dst_cache &&
+           sock->sk->sk_dst_cache->dev &&
+           !strcmp(sock->sk->sk_dst_cache->dev->name, name_intrf))
+               return true;
+
+       return false;
+}
+
+static int entry_handler_wf_sock(struct kretprobe_instance *ri,
+                                struct pt_regs *regs)
+{
+       bool *ok = (bool *)ri->data;
+       struct socket *socket = (struct socket *)swap_get_karg(regs, 0);
+
+       *ok = check_wlan0(socket);
+
+       return 0;
+}
+
+static int ret_handler_wf_sock_recv(struct kretprobe_instance *ri,
+                                   struct pt_regs *regs)
+{
+       int ret = regs_return_value(regs);
+
+       if (ret > 0) {
+               bool ok = *(bool *)ri->data;
+
+               if (ok) {
+                       struct energy_data *ed;
+
+                       ed = get_energy_data(current);
+                       if (ed)
+                               atomic64_add(ret, &ed->bytes_recv);
+                       atomic64_add(ret, &ed_system.bytes_recv);
+               }
+       }
+
+       return 0;
+}
+
+static int ret_handler_wf_sock_send(struct kretprobe_instance *ri,
+                                   struct pt_regs *regs)
+{
+       int ret = regs_return_value(regs);
+
+       if (ret > 0) {
+               bool ok = *(bool *)ri->data;
+
+               if (ok) {
+                       struct energy_data *ed;
+
+                       ed = get_energy_data(current);
+                       if (ed)
+                               atomic64_add(ret, &ed->bytes_send);
+                       atomic64_add(ret, &ed_system.bytes_send);
+               }
+       }
+
+       return 0;
+}
+
+static struct kretprobe sock_recv_krp = {
+       .entry_handler = entry_handler_wf_sock,
+       .handler = ret_handler_wf_sock_recv,
+       .data_size = sizeof(bool)
+};
+
+static struct kretprobe sock_send_krp = {
+       .entry_handler = entry_handler_wf_sock,
+       .handler = ret_handler_wf_sock_send,
+       .data_size = sizeof(bool)
+};
+
+static int energy_wifi_once(void)
+{
+       const char *sym;
+
+       sym = "sock_recvmsg";
+       sock_recv_krp.kp.addr = (kprobe_opcode_t *)swap_ksyms(sym);
+       if (sock_recv_krp.kp.addr == NULL)
+               goto not_found;
+
+       sym = "sock_sendmsg";
+       sock_send_krp.kp.addr = (kprobe_opcode_t *)swap_ksyms(sym);
+       if (sock_send_krp.kp.addr == NULL)
+               goto  not_found;
+
+       return 0;
+
+not_found:
+       printk(KERN_INFO "ERROR: symbol '%s' not found\n", sym);
+       return -ESRCH;
+}
+
+static int energy_wifi_flag = 0;
+
+static int energy_wifi_set(void)
+{
+       int ret;
+
+       ret = swap_register_kretprobe(&sock_recv_krp);
+       if (ret) {
+               pr_err("swap_register_kretprobe(sock_recv_krp) ret=%d\n" ,ret);
+               return ret;
+       }
+
+       ret = swap_register_kretprobe(&sock_send_krp);
+       if (ret) {
+               pr_err("swap_register_kretprobe(sock_send_krp) ret=%d\n" ,ret);
+               swap_unregister_kretprobe(&sock_recv_krp);
+       }
+
+       energy_wifi_flag = 1;
+
+       return ret;
+}
+
+static void energy_wifi_unset(void)
+{
+       if (energy_wifi_flag == 0)
+               return;
+
+       swap_unregister_kretprobe(&sock_send_krp);
+       swap_unregister_kretprobe(&sock_recv_krp);
+
+       energy_wifi_flag = 0;
+}
